Lihir Gold Mine's ore processing capabilities. The mine was upgraded with the installation of one additional autoclave of twice the capacity of each of the three existing autoclaves, as well as additional crushing, grinding, thickening, oxygen, and leach plant facilities. The Lihir ore mill achieved a throughput capacity of 15Mtpa in 2019 ...

The processing of gold copper and copper gold ores can be highly problematic, site specific and the process selection is dependent on ore grade, mineralogy, acid leach behaviour, cyanide chemistry, product saleability and environmental considerations.
In March 2023, the last ore from the underground mine was hauled to the surface and processed through the plant, and Hera's surface facilities were transitioned to care and maintenance in April 2023. The 455ktpa process plant is equipped with a three-stage crushing, gravity gold, base metal flotation and concentrate leach circuits.
A-Z Guide to Screening Ore, Rock & Aggregate A simple definition of a "screen" is a machine with surface(s) used to classify materials by size. Screening is defined as "The mechanical process which accomplishes a division of particles on the basis of size and their acceptance or rejection by a screening surface". Knowledge of …
Roasting of refractory gold ore with a composition of 180 kg NaClO 3 and 180 kg water/ton ore reached a temperature of 470 °C at a microwave power of 400 watts for 30 minutes. Total oxidized sulfur reached 90.6%, while only 10.4 % of the sulfur was released, and chlorine release was 49.5%.

The gold cyanidation process is the most important method ever developed for extracting gold from its ores. The reasons the widespread acceptance of cyanidation are economic as well as metallurgical. It usually obtains a higher recovery of gold than plate amalgamation and is easier to operate than the chlorine or bromine process. It produces …
